Strategic competitive advantage comes from having an edge, advantage or superiority over the competition. navigate here Strategy is the game plan for achieving competitive advantage. Competitive strategy is the process of determining how you will use competitive advantage to achieve growth, profitability and ultimately success in your industry. A good competitive strategy provides your organization with the competitive edge needed to win against your competition.
